West Elementary is a State/Public serving elementary age pupils, located in Kings Mountain, Cleveland County. The school has 290 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Cleveland County Schools school district. It serves grades Pre-Kโ4 in a small-town setting. The school employs 22.6 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 12.8:1. 47% of students are proficient in reading. 42% are proficient in maths. West Elementary enrolls 290 students across grades Pre-Kโ4. The student body is 54% male and 46% female. A teaching staff of 22.6 full-time-equivalent teachers supports the school, giving a student-teacher ratio of 12.8:1.
By race and ethnicity, the student body is 67% White, 24% Black or African American and 4.1% Two or more races.

174 of the school's 290 students (60%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Of these, 170 qualify for free lunch and 4 for a reduced price. The school participates in the National School Lunch Program.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.
West Elementary is located in a small-town setting (NCES locale: Town, Fringe). The school runs a schoolwide Title I program, which provides federal funding to support students from low-income families. West Elementary is one of 28 schools in Cleveland County Schools, based in Shelby, North Carolina. The district serves 14,504 students district-wide and employs 981 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 290 students, West Elementary is smaller than the district average of about 518 students per school.
